How much do technical writer remote environmental j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for technical writer remote environmental in the United States is $38.94,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$28.85 and $47.12 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Technical Writer in a remote environmental role,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Technical Writer in a remote environmental role, you need strong writing, editing, and research skills, often supported by a degree in English, communications, or environmental science. Familiarity with documentation tools such as Microsoft Word, Adobe Acrobat, and content management systems, as well as knowledge of environmental regulations or standards, is typically required. Attention to detail, self-motivation, and excellent communication skills are essential for producing clear, accurate documents and collaborating virtually with subject matter experts. These skills ensure effective communication of complex environmental information, regulatory compliance, and successful teamwork across remote settings.

What are Technical Writer Remote Environmental jobs?

Technical Writer Remote Environmental jobs involve creating clear and accurate documentation related to environmental topics, such as regulatory compliance, sustainability initiatives, and technical processes, often for organizations in the environmental sector. These writers work remotely, allowing them to collaborate with teams and subject matter experts from different locations. Their typical responsibilities include researching complex environmental issues, translating technical information into accessible language, and producing materials like reports, manuals, and guides. A strong understanding of environmental science and excellent writing skills are essential for this role.

How do Technical Writers working remotely in the environmental sector typically collaborate with subject matter experts to ensure accuracy?

Remote Technical Writers in the environmental sector often rely on a mix of video conferences, collaborative document tools, and scheduled interviews to connect with scientists, engineers, and project managers. Since much of the expert knowledge is highly specialized, clear communication and proactive scheduling are essential to avoid misunderstandings. Writers may also participate in virtual team meetings and use project management software to track feedback and revisions. This approach helps maintain accuracy and ensures documentation aligns with the latest industry standards and project goals.

Job description

Overview
Please note that this position is contingent upon the successful award of a contract currently under bid.
Goldbelt Apex, a part of the Healthcare Technology Transformation Group, is a data-focused company dedicated to process and quality in every aspect. As experts in healthcare IT, Apex is committed to building systems for healthcare organizations to seamlessly communicate and exchange data across different systems and devices.
Summary:
Goldbelt Apex is seeking a skilled Technical Writer to produce clear, accurate, and compliant documentation supporting a complex federal data governance initiative. This role is responsible for authoring high-quality reports, governance materials, standards documents, and supporting artifacts that facilitate stakeholder communication, knowledge transfer, and process adherence. The Technical Writer will translate complex technical concepts into accessible, well-structured content while ensuring consistency, version control, and alignment with federal standards throughout the performance period.
This position provides an opportunity to contribute to meaningful federal documentation efforts within a collaborative, high-retention organization dedicated to excellence and mission support.
*This role is based in Falls Church, VA with possible telework.
Responsibilities
Essential Job Functions:
  • Author and edit technical reports, governance playbooks, standards documents, data dictionaries, and other deliverables to support project objectives and stakeholder needs.
  • Document reusable components, workflows, metadata standards, and governance processes with precision and clarity.
  • Ensure all written materials are compliant with federal regulations, privacy standards (e.g., HIPAA), and organizational style guidelines.
  • Translate complex technical and governance-related information into plain language suitable for diverse audiences, including leadership and technical teams.
  • Support monthly status reporting by preparing concise, accurate summaries and updates.
  • Maintain document lifecycle management, including version control, formatting consistency, and archiving using approved collaboration tools.
  • Collaborate with project teams, subject matter experts, and reviewers to gather input, incorporate feedback, and finalize deliverables.
  • Conduct quality reviews and proofreading to ensure grammatical accuracy, structural integrity, and readability.
  • Produce various content types, including procedural guides, executive summaries, and knowledge-transfer materials.

Qualifications
Necessary Skills and Knowledge:
  • Exceptional writing and editing skills, with strong attention to grammar, clarity, structure, and readability.
  • Proficiency in translating complex technical concepts into clear, concise, and audience-appropriate language.
  • Familiarity with document lifecycle practices, version control systems, and content management tools.
  • Ability to adhere to established style guides (e.g., AP style or federal documentation standards) and produce consistent, professional deliverables.
  • Strong organizational skills to manage multiple documents and deadlines effectively.

Minimum Qualifications:
  • Bachelor's degree in Technical Writing, Communications, English, Information Technology, or a related field.
  • Minimum 3-5 years of experience in technical writing, documentation development, or related roles, including at least 2 years in federal, healthcare, or regulated environments.
  • Demonstrated ability to produce high-quality technical documentation, reports, and standards materials under tight deadlines.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ite (Word, PowerPoint, SharePoint) and document collaboration platforms.
  • Active Secret security clearance (or eligibility) at the level required for federal access.

Preferred Qualifications:
  • Experience supporting federal data governance, health IT, or compliance-related documentation efforts.
  • Familiarity with federal documentation standards, governance reporting, or data management frameworks.
  • Prior work involving monthly status reporting, stakeholder-facing materials, or knowledge-transfer artifacts.
  • Knowledge of content management systems (CMS) and publishing platforms used in regulated environments.
